Today's word is:

        unequivocably (un,-E-kwiv'-;-k;-blE) - adv. definitely,
        clearly, without a doubt.

        "At least in the minds of the jurors in the mock trial, Mary had
         unequivocably proven that John was guilty of stealing the
         cupcake."
